Slate tile floor repair services involve restoring the appearance and structural integrity of slate flooring that has become damaged or worn over time. This process typically includes assessing the condition of the existing tiles, removing any cracked, chipped, or loose pieces, and replacing them with matching slate to maintain the original look. In some cases, repairs may also involve regrouting or sealing the tiles to prevent future damage and improve the floor’s durability.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ques to ensure that the repair work blends seamlessly with the existing slate, helping to preserve the natural beauty of the material.

Slate floors can develop a variety of problems that impact both their appearance and safety. Common issues include cracked or broken tiles caused by impacts or shifting subfloors, loose tiles that create uneven surfaces, and grout deterioration that allows water infiltration. Over time, slate may also lose its natural luster or develop stains that are difficult to remove. Repairing these problems helps prevent further damage, such as water damage or increased cracking, and restores the floor’s functionality. Addressing issues early can also help avoid more costly replacements or extensive renovations in the future.

The overview below groups typical Slate Tile Floor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Rosemount, MN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ically range from $250 to $600 for common fixes like crack filling or small chip repairs on slate tile floors.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and tile condition.

Moderate Restoration - Expect costs between $600 and $1,500 for more extensive work such as replacing several damaged tiles or re-sealing large areas.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to restore appearance and durability.

Extensive Repairs - Larger, more complex projects like partial replacements or addressing underlying issues can cost $1,500 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ach this tier, often involving multiple rooms or significant structural concerns.

Full Floor Replacement - Complete removal and installation of new slate flooring can range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more, depending on size and quality of materials. This is typically reserved for major renovations or when repairs are no longer feasible.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of slate tile floor damage can local contractors repair? They can handle issues like cracks, chips, stains, and surface wear to restore the appearance and integrity of slate tile floors.

Are there common causes for slate tile floor damage that service providers see? Yes, damage often results from heavy foot traffic, improper cleaning, moisture intrusion, or impact from heavy objects.

Can slate tile floors be repaired without replacing the entire surface? In many cases, local contractors can perform spot repairs or resurfacing to address damage without full replacement.

What repair methods do local pros typically use for slate tile floors? They may use techniques like filling cracks, re-sealing tiles, or replacing damaged tiles to improve durability and appearance.

How can homeowners maintain slate tile floors after repairs are completed? Regular cleaning, proper sealing, and avoiding harsh chemicals can help preserve the repaired surface and prevent future damage.
